Analyzing Bitcoin Stability

Bitcoin’s stability is an integral component of online gambling for both gamblers and operators. Price fluctuations can dramatically impact winnings, creating both opportunities and risks:

  • Price Volatility: Bitcoin’s price can change rapidly and dramatically over a short period, altering deposits and withdrawals accordingly.
  • Market Influences: External factors like regulatory news, technological developments, and market sentiment can quickly shift Bitcoin’s worth.

Regulatory Considerations

The regulatory landscape surrounding Bitcoin gambling remains complex and ever-evolving. Different countries take different positions regarding cryptocurrency and gambling, which impact how Bitcoin can be utilized within such contexts:

  • Bitcoin is recognized in certain regions as a legitimate means of transaction, while in others, it is subject to restrictions or bans.
  • Such regulatory changes can potentially restrict or even extensively prohibit the use of Bitcoin for gambling purposes.
